Region’s in-migration shows signs of waning
Is King County’s growth attributed to in-migration waning? Statistics from the state’s Department of Licensing suggest it may be. Seattle Times columnist Gene Balk analyzed DOL data and found the number of driver’s licenses issued to new King County residents from out of state declined for the second straight year. [..]

Housing market rebounds from February freeze
KIRKLAND, Washington (April 5, 2019) – Both pending sales and new listing activity around Western Washington surged during March as buyers, sellers, and brokers emerged from February’s record snowfall. Brokers added 10,516 new listings of single family homes and condos to the Northwest Multiple Listing Service inventory last month, the [..]

Seattle City Council unanimously passes MHA upzones
The Seattle City Council on March 18 voted unanimously in favor of neighborhood upzones associated with the Mandatory Housing Affordability (MHA) program. The upzones will impact 27 transit centers around the city, some of which are already zoned for commercial and apartment buildings. The MHA program has been controversial with [..]

Washington homeowners pay 12th highest real estate taxes in U.S.
Homeowners in the state of Washington pay the 12th highest real estate taxes per year, according to an analysis by the National Association of Home Builders. The federation, whose members construct about 80 percent of the new homes built in the U.S., found property tax rates differ substantially across the [..]
